T+A Pulsar S 130vsATC SCM40

The T+A Pulsar S 130 stands 100.0 cm tall — about 2.0 cm more than the ATC SCM40 at 98.0 cm. On footprint the ATC SCM40 is the wider cabinet (35.1 cm versus 27.0 cm). At 86 dB against 85 dB, the T+A Pulsar S 130 is the easier load to drive and plays louder from the same amplifier. The T+A Pulsar S 130 reaches deeper in the bass, down to 32 Hz versus 48 Hz. Low frequencies come from a 150 mm cone on the T+A Pulsar S 130 and a 165 mm cone on the ATC SCM40. Both land in a similar price bracket, around $5,950 a pair.
